Decoloration process of phenyllactic acid fermentation broth and its adsorption isotherm

Abstract
The decoloration effect of four kinds of activated carbon on phenyllactic acid fermentation broth was studied based on the decoloration rate and the recovery ratio of phenyllactic acid. The decoloration experiments were carried out by single factor experiments and orthogonal experiments. The optimal conditions for decoloration were determined as follows:1.5% activated carbon addition, initial pH 6.5, temperature 90℃, decoloration time 30 min. The results show that under these conditions, the decoloration rate of active carbon (AC1) reaches 90.5%, and phenyllactic acid recovery rote reaches 88.6%. The adsorption isotherm was also studied in the decoloration system of fermentation broth, and it was verified that the adsorption process follows the Freundlich equation.关键词
